Notes for HUBERT STEVEN PATE:
Died un-married.

Mary Campbell Norton's  diary entry for January 27, 1940:
 quot;Gosh, what a shock! Robert just came in and said Hubert Pate was dead!  Died last night. Gased. 
 No details quot;.
January 28, 1940:
  quot;Robert & I went out to Nathan's awhile and over to Pate's tonight. Sure was sad! Stayed until 
 9:00pm. Cold. Everything froze up. quot;
January 29, 1940: quot;Annie Ruth & Clayton went with Robert & me to Hubert's funeral. Poor Mrs. Pate. 
Too bad. .... Cold, for goodness sakequot;.

(Hubert and an unknown room-mate were asphyxiated, while in bed asleep, by gas in a hotel or boarding 
house. This happened somewhere in Washington, DC.)

10.  CARRIE5 PATE (STEVEN W.4, ELIJAH3, STEPHEN2, THOROUGHGOOD1) was born September 18, 1882 in 
Scotland County, and died June 06, 1961 in Laurinburg, Scotland County.  She married JOHN A. BARBER 
September 1907 in Bennettsville, SC, son of HUGH BARBER.  He was born 1871.

Notes for CARRIE PATE:
For many years Carrie operated a boarding house on Everette Street in Laurinburg.  Carrie died at 
Scotland Memorial Hosp. where she had been a patient for 10 days.  She sustained a broken hip in a 
fall late in May.  Bur. Barber-Pate Cemetery

John A. Barber, 33 and  Miss Carrie Pate 25, of Scotland County, N.C.  m.  about Sept. 5, 1907 in 
BennettsvilleWitnesses were C. C. Snead, A. H. (?) Jackson, Eli Norton
